๐Ÿ†˜ Universal EU Emergency Number โ€” 112

112 works in ALL European Union countries for police, ambulance, or fire services.

  • โœ“ Works even without a SIM card
  • โœ“ Works even with no credit
  • โœ“ Works even if phone is locked
  • โœ“ Operators speak English
  • โœ“ GPS location automatically sent

What to Do in an Emergency

  1. Stay calm and assess the situation
  2. Call 112 (EU) or the local emergency number for police, ambulance, or fire
  3. Contact the Philippine Embassy in your host country for consular assistance
  4. Call the DFA 24/7 hotline at +63 2 8834 4663 for additional support
  5. Notify family in the Philippines about your situation
  6. Contact OWWA at +63 2 8891 7601 for welfare assistance
